Responsibilities
- Interpret engineering prints and 3D models to create accurate CNC programs for Swiss and milling machine centers.
- Set up CNC machines and machining centers to produce components that meet specification and quality requirements.
- Select cutting tools that provide cost-effective tool life and fully utilize tooling capabilities.
- Develop capable, cost-effective, and sustainable machining processes for new and existing products.
- Write clear work instructions and procedures to support manufacturing processes and ensure repeatability.
- Advocate for and implement high quality standards and Lean manufacturing principles throughout daily work.
- Audit, interpret, and communicate technical specifications and requirements to all relevant departments.
- Identify, plan, and complete continuous improvement projects, including cycle time reduction and perishable tooling selection and cost reduction.
- Create, coordinate, and document engineering tests to validate processes and tooling.
- Perform quality assurance tests and inspections to verify compliance with specifications and regulatory requirements.
- Assist in or lead the development of tooling designs and CNC programming for complex parts.
- Maintain and improve machining and secondary operational processes to ensure consistent performance and output.
- Support process validation activities and documentation as needed for medical device manufacturing.
- Collaborate closely with engineering, production, and quality teams to support new product introduction and ongoing production.
